Kimberley Walsh: I love Cheryl but I would hate her life
SINGER Kimberley Walsh says she does not envy the fame of former Girls Aloud bandmate Cheryl Fernandez- Versini.
PALS: Cheryl and Kimberley are still friends
Whereas Cheryl remains in the limelight and was judging last night’s X Factor, Kimberley has kept a lower profile, albeit one which has seen her appear on stage in the West End and write an autobiography.
As a band, Girls Aloud scored four number one hits and sold four million albums.
They split in 2009, reformed in 2012 and called it a day in 2013.

Kimberly, 33, remains close friends with Cheryl but admitted she would not want to be under the same intense spotlight.
She told S Magazine: “She handles it so well, but it’s definitely challenging.
“She sees all the things I can do and she’s like, ‘How do you manage it?’

“I get the best of both worlds because I’m still doing what I love without the pressure that she has.
"I can still go to the shops and all those normal things. I’m toeing a good line.”

She said there are no plans for the band to get back together, adding: “There are definitely no plans to reunite. Everyone’s doing their own thing now.
“We had more than a decade together and we’ve probably outstayed our welcome.”

Kimberley, who made her West End debut in Shrek The Musical in 2011, became a mother last year to 13-month-old Bobby.

She is due to marry her partner Justin Scott next year.
She said: “We’ve started planning. “I’m so looking forward to it.”
